New York Institute of Technologys six schools and colleges offer undergraduate graduate and professional degree programs in indemand disciplines including computer science data science and cybersecurity; biology health professions and medicine; architecture and design; engineering; IT and digital technologies; management; and energy and sustainability. A nonprofit independent private and nonsectarian institute of higher education founded in 1955 it welcomes nearly 8000 students worldwide.
The university has campuses in New York City and Long Island New York; Jonesboro Arkansas; and Vancouver British Columbia as well as programs around the world. Nearly 110000 alumni are part of an engaged network of physicians architects scientists engineers business leaders digital artists and healthcare professionals. Together the universitys community of doers makers healers and innovators empowers graduates to change the world solve 21stcentury challenges and reinvent the future.

New York Institute of Technology seeks an Associate Director for the Office of the Dean at the College of Osteopathic Medicine located on the Long Island (Old Westbury NY) campus.
Work with Principle Investigators (PI) on postaward grants for the COM in OW & Arkansas. Manage expenses & positions & ensure budgets are spent appropriately.
Monitor collaborative agreement expenses associated with grants.
Manage the grant budget & review expenditures & monitor spending in each budget line.
Provide reports to PIs with grant expenditures & balances.
Create database for contracts.
Perform other duties as assigned.
A Bachelors Degree is required.
Budgeting and financial experience is required; grant experience is preferred.
Must have strong EXCEL and computer skills.
Must have knowledge of Oracle and Data Warehouse.
Must have excellent communications skills and ability to work independently.
